Output 1eec0832a61ba78d02aeb48d764f79d3c73417f3cded50fc153862cafd498ea5:0

value
306325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d40488099efff7767fe80b12143c8298be847ed OP_EQUAL
address
3MrtGQyX9Ywt9pmZKRPH9ZKfskvTMAVBD5
transaction
1eec0832a61ba78d02aeb48d764f79d3c73417f3cded50fc153862cafd498ea5
confirmations
255303
spent
true